Monthly Cost of Living
🙂Monthly costs for one person with rent: $712 in China versus $1,079 in Aruba.
🙂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,131 in China versus $1,759 in Aruba.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$1,549 in China versus $2,438 in Aruba.
🌍Living in China costs about 34% less than in Aruba on average.
📊Both countries sit below the global median: China 47% lower, Aruba 19% lower.

Cost Breakdown
🏠National rent averages: $287 in China, $540 in Aruba. Capital cities: $909 in Beijing (Pekin) vs $669 in Oranjestad.
💰National salary averages: $857 in China, $2,436 in Aruba. Higher pay doesn't always mean more spending money – weigh income against local costs.
Cost Highlights
⭐Rent is 88% higher in Aruba.
⭐Dining out costs 67% more in Aruba.
⭐Public transport is 28% more expensive in Aruba.
⭐Salaries are 184% higher in Aruba, and purchasing power comes out stronger in Aruba.
